Tom Scocca Leaves Slate for Deadspin

It’s hard to imagine Deadspin with more of an edge, but if anyone can bring it, it’s Slate’s Tom Scocca. A.J. Daulerio, Deadspin’s Editor-in-Chief, announced yesterday evening that Scocca will be joining the sports site as Managing Editor.

Scocca then followed that announcement up with a final post to his Slate blog:

When I got up this morning, or even when I had lunch, I didn’t really know I’d be shutting the blog down today, on the 698th post (Go for 700, already, cries the part of the brain conditioned to tend the Tamagotchi). That’s how the instant horizon works. Get mad about Bill Simmons’ taste in shoes and—oh, time to make an announcement: I’m going to be managing editor of Deadspin.
